nov 11, 1689 - Bill of Rights

Description:

- Free and regular elections
- Army could not be raised in peace time without parliamentary consent
- Mutiny Acts: King could not court martial w/out parliament's consent, king had to recall parliament every year to renew the act
- Monarch still free to appoint own advisers, had control of foreign policy and war
- Did not create a procedure to remove arbitrary monarchs
